Deck Board Replacement in Redmond, WA
Deck board replacement services involve removing damaged, rotted, or worn-out boards and installing new ones to restore the safety and appearance of a deck. This service is commonly requested for projects where individual boards have become cracked, splintered, or compromised due to weather exposure or age. Property owners typically want to understand the types of materials available, such as wood or composite, and how the replacement process will match the existing deck’s design and structure to ensure a seamless look.
Before requesting deck board replacement, homeowners often seek information about the scope of work, including whether only select boards or the entire deck surface will be addressed. It’s also helpful to consider the condition of the underlying framing and support structure, as these may need assessment or repair if damaged. Clarifying these details can help property owners make informed decisions about maintaining or upgrading their outdoor living space.

Deck Board Replacement Questions
What are deck boards? Deck boards are the horizontal planks that make up the surface of a deck, providing a stable walking surface for outdoor spaces.
When should deck boards be replaced? Replacement is recommended when boards are rotting, cracked, warped, or loose, affecting safety and appearance.
What types of materials are used for deck board replacement? Common materials include pressure-treated wood, composite, and PVC options, chosen based on durability and style preferences.
How can I tell if my deck boards need replacing? Signs include visible damage, splintering, mold growth, or if boards feel soft or unstable underfoot.
